METHOD AND APPARATUS FOR SELECTING BETWEEN MULTIPLE EQUAL COST PATHS
    1.
    发明申请
    METHOD AND APPARATUS FOR SELECTING BETWEEN MULTIPLE EQUAL COST PATHS 失效
    用于选择多个等效成本的方法和装置

    公开(公告)号:US20120307832A1

    公开(公告)日:2012-12-06

    申请号:US13589372

    申请日:2012-08-20

    IPC分类号: H04L12/28

    摘要: Each equal cost path is assigned a path ID created by concatenating an ordered set of link IDs which form the path through the network. The link IDs are created from the node IDs on either set of the link. The link IDs are sorted from lowest to highest to facilitate ranking of the paths. The low and high ranked paths are selected from this ranked list as the first set of diverse paths through the network. Each of the link IDs on each of the paths is then renamed, for example by inverting either all of the high node IDs or low node IDs. After re-naming the links, new path IDs are created by concatenating an ordered set of renamed link IDs. The paths are then re-ranked and the low and high re-ranked paths are selected from this re-ranked list as the second set of diverse paths.

    摘要翻译: 为每个相等的成本路径指定了通过连接形成通过网络的路径的有序的链路ID组创建的路径ID。 链接ID是从链路的任一组上的节点ID创建的。 链接ID从最低到最高排列,以便于路径的排名。 从这个排名列表中选择低和高排名的路径作为通过网络的第一组不同路径。 然后,每个路径上的每个链路ID被重命名,例如通过反转所有高节点ID或低节点ID。 在链接重新命名之后,通过连接重命名的链接ID的有序集来创建新的路径ID。 然后将路径重新排列,并且从该重新排列的列表中选择低和高重新排序的路径作为第二组不同路径。

    BREAK BEFORE MAKE FORWARDING INFORMATION BASE (FIB) POPULATION FOR MULTICAST
    2.
    发明申请
    BREAK BEFORE MAKE FORWARDING INFORMATION BASE (FIB) POPULATION FOR MULTICAST 有权
    在为MULTICAST提供前向信息库(FIB)人口之前BREAK

    公开(公告)号:US20090180400A1

    公开(公告)日:2009-07-16

    申请号:US12260558

    申请日:2008-10-29

    IPC分类号: H04L12/28

    摘要: A method of installing forwarding state in a link state protocol controlled network node having a topology database representing a known topology of the network, and at least two ports for communication with corresponding peers of the network node. A unicast path is computed from the node to a second node in the network, using the topology database, and unicast forwarding state associated with the computed unicast path installed in a filtering database (FDB) of the node. Multicast forwarding state is removed for multicast trees originating at the second node if an unsafe condition is detected. Subsequently, a “safe” indication signal is advertised to each of the peers of the network node. The “safe” indication signal comprises a digest of the topology database. A multicast path is then computed from the network node to at least one destination node of a multicast tree originating at the second node. Finally, multicast forwarding state associated with the computed multicast path is installed in the filtering database (FDB) of the network node, when predetermined safe condition is satisfied.

    摘要翻译: 一种在具有表示网络的已知拓扑的拓扑数据库的链路状态协议控制网络节点中安装转发状态的方法,以及用于与网络节点的相应对等体进行通信的至少两个端口。 使用拓扑数据库从网络中的节点到第二节点计算单播路径,以及与安装在节点的过滤数据库(FDB)中的计算的单播路径相关联的单播转发状态。 如果检测到不安全状况,则组播转发状态将被删除。 随后,向网络节点的每个对等体通告“安全”指示信号。 “安全”指示信号包括拓扑数据库的摘要。 然后,从网络节点计算多播路径到源于第二节点的多播树的至少一个目的地节点。 最后,当满足预定的安全条件时,安装在网络节点的过滤数据库(FDB)中与计算出的组播路径相关联的组播转发状态。

    Provider link state bridging (PLSB) computation method
    3.
    发明授权
    Provider link state bridging (PLSB) computation method 失效
    提供商链路状态桥接(PLSB)计算方法

    公开(公告)号:US08605627B2

    公开(公告)日:2013-12-10

    申请号:US13204309

    申请日:2011-08-05

    IPC分类号: H04L12/28

    摘要: A method of multicast route computation in a link state protocol controlled network. A spanning tree is computed from a first node to every other node in the network using a known spanning tree protocol. The network is then divided into two or more partitions, each partition encompassing an immediate neighbor node of the first node and any nodes of the network subtending the neighbor node on the spanning tree. Two or more of the partitions are merged when a predetermined criterion is satisfied. Nodes within all of the partitions except a largest one of the partitions are then identified, and each identified node examined to identify node pairs for which a respective shortest path traverses the first node.

    摘要翻译: 一种链路状态协议控制网络中组播路由计算的方法。 使用已知的生成树协议从网络中的第一节点到每个其他节点计算生成树。 然后将网络划分成两个或更多个分区,每个分区包含第一节点的直接邻居节点和对生成树上的邻居节点的网络的任何节点。 当满足预定标准时,两个或多个分区被合并。 然后识别除了最大分区之外的所有分区内的节点,并且检查每个识别的节点以识别相应的最短路径穿过第一节点的节点对。

    Tie-breaking in shortest path determination
    4.
    发明授权
    Tie-breaking in shortest path determination 有权
    在最短路径确定中断断

    公开(公告)号:US07911944B2

    公开(公告)日:2011-03-22

    申请号:US11964478

    申请日:2007-12-26

    IPC分类号: G01R31/08

    摘要: A consistent tie-breaking decision between equal-cost shortest (lowest cost) paths is achieved by comparing an ordered set of node identifiers for each of a plurality of end-to-end paths. Alternatively, the same results can be achieved, on-the-fly, as a shortest path tree is constructed, by making a selection of an equal-cost path using the node identifiers of the diverging branches of the tree. Both variants allow a consistent selection to be made of equal-cost paths, regardless of where in the network the shortest paths are calculated. This ensures that traffic flow between any two nodes, in both the forward and reverse directions, will always follow the same path through the network.

    摘要翻译: 通过比较多个端到端路径中的每一个的有序节点标识符集来实现等成本最短(最低成本)路径之间的一致的打破决定。 或者,通过使用树的分支分支的节点标识符选择等价路径,可以实时地实现与最短路径树相同的结果。 这两种变体允许对等成本路径进行一致的选择,而不管网络中哪些地方计算最短路径。 这确保任何两个节点之间在正向和反向方向上的业务流量将始终遵循通过网络的相同路径。

    Method and apparatus for multicast implementation in a routed ethernet mesh network
    6.
    发明授权
    Method and apparatus for multicast implementation in a routed ethernet mesh network 有权
    在路由以太网网状网络中组播实现的方法和装置

    公开(公告)号:US09444720B2

    公开(公告)日:2016-09-13

    申请号:US12435973

    申请日:2009-05-05

    摘要: Interest in multicast group membership may be advertised via a routing system on an Ethernet network along with an indication of an algorithm to be used by the nodes on the network to calculate the distribution tree or trees for the multicast. Each node, upon receipt of the advertisement, will determine the algorithm that is to be used to produce the multicast tree and will use the algorithm to calculate whether it is on a path between nodes advertising common interest in the multicast. Example algorithms may include shortest path algorithms and spanning tree algorithms. This allows multicast membership to be managed via the routing control plane, while enabling spanning tree processes to be used to forward multicast traffic. Since spanning tree is able to install multicast state per service rather than per source per service, this reduces the amount of forwarding state required to implement multicasts on the routed Ethernet mesh network.

    摘要翻译: 可以通过以太网网络上的路由系统以及由网络上的节点使用的算法的指示来广播对组播组成员的兴趣,以计算组播的分布树或树。 每个节点在接收到广告时将确定要用于生成多播树的算法,并且将使用该算法来计算是否在节点之间的路径上,广播广播上的共同兴趣。 示例算法可以包括最短路径算法和生成树算法。 这允许通过路由控制平面管理多播成员资格,同时使用生成树进程来转发组播流量。 由于生成树能够按服务安装多播状态,而不是每个服务的每个源,因此减少了在路由以太网网络上实现组播所需的转发状态量。

    TIE-BREAKING IN SHORTEST PATH DETERMINATION
    7.
    发明申请
    TIE-BREAKING IN SHORTEST PATH DETERMINATION 失效
    在最短路径确定中进行切割

    公开(公告)号:US20110128857A1

    公开(公告)日:2011-06-02

    申请号:US13023823

    申请日:2011-02-09

    IPC分类号: H04L12/26

    摘要: A consistent tie-breaking decision between equal-cost shortest (lowest cost) paths is achieved by comparing an ordered set of node identifiers for each of a plurality of end-to-end paths. Alternatively, the same results can be achieved, on-the-fly, as a shortest path tree is constructed, by making a selection of an equal-cost path using the node identifiers of the diverging branches of the tree. Both variants allow a consistent selection to be made of equal-cost paths, regardless of where in the network the shortest paths are calculated. This ensures that traffic flow between any two nodes, in both the forward and reverse directions, will always follow the same path through the network.

    摘要翻译: 通过比较多个端到端路径中的每一个的有序节点标识符集来实现等成本最短(最低成本)路径之间的一致的断开决定。 或者,通过使用树的分支分支的节点标识符选择等价路径,可以实时地实现与最短路径树相同的结果。 这两种变体允许对等成本路径进行一致的选择,而不管网络中哪些地方计算最短路径。 这确保任何两个节点之间在正向和反向方向上的业务流量将始终遵循通过网络的相同路径。

    Break before make forwarding information base (FIB) population for multicast
    8.
    发明授权
    Break before make forwarding information base (FIB) population for multicast 有权
    在转发信息库(FIB)群播前进行多播

    公开(公告)号:US07924836B2

    公开(公告)日:2011-04-12

    申请号:US12260558

    申请日:2008-10-29

    IPC分类号: H04L12/28

    摘要: A method of installing forwarding state in a link state protocol controlled network node having a topology database representing a known topology of the network, and at least two ports for communication with corresponding peers of the network node. A unicast path is computed from the node to a second node in the network, using the topology database, and unicast forwarding state associated with the computed unicast path installed in a filtering database (FDB) of the node. Multicast forwarding state is removed for multicast trees originating at the second node if an unsafe condition is detected. Subsequently, a “safe” indication signal is advertised to each of the peers of the network node. The “safe” indication signal comprises a digest of the topology database. A multicast path is then computed from the network node to at least one destination node of a multicast tree originating at the second node. Finally, multicast forwarding state associated with the computed multicast path is installed in the filtering database (FDB) of the network node, when predetermined safe condition is satisfied.

    摘要翻译: 一种在具有表示网络的已知拓扑的拓扑数据库的链路状态协议控制网络节点中安装转发状态的方法,以及用于与网络节点的相应对等体进行通信的至少两个端口。 使用拓扑数据库从网络中的节点到第二节点计算单播路径,以及与安装在节点的过滤数据库(FDB)中的计算的单播路径相关联的单播转发状态。 如果检测到不安全状况,则组播转发状态将被删除。 随后,向网络节点的每个对等体通告“安全”指示信号。 “安全”指示信号包括拓扑数据库的摘要。 然后,从网络节点计算多播路径到源于第二节点的多播树的至少一个目的地节点。 最后,当满足预定的安全条件时,安装在网络节点的过滤数据库(FDB)中与计算出的组播路径相关联的组播转发状态。

    Method and apparatus for selecting between multiple equal cost paths
    9.
    发明授权
    Method and apparatus for selecting between multiple equal cost paths 失效
    用于在多个等成本路径之间进行选择的方法和装置

    公开(公告)号:US08248925B2

    公开(公告)日:2012-08-21

    申请号:US12574872

    申请日:2009-10-07

    IPC分类号: G01R31/08

    摘要: Each equal cost path is assigned a path ID created by concatenating an ordered set of link IDs which form the path through the network. The link IDs are created from the node IDs on either set of the link. The link IDs are sorted from lowest to highest when creating the path ID to facilitate ranking of the paths. The low and high ranked paths are selected from this ranked list as the first set of diverse paths through the network. Each of the link IDs on each of the paths is then renamed, for example by inverting either all of the high node IDs or low node IDs. After re-naming the links, new path IDs are created by concatenating an ordered set of renamed link IDs. The paths are then re-ranked and the low and high re-ranked paths are selected from this re-ranked list as the second set of diverse paths through the network. Selective naming of node IDs and use of different inversion functions can be exploited to further optimize distribution of traffic on the network.

    摘要翻译: 为每个相等的成本路径指定了通过连接形成通过网络的路径的有序的链路ID组创建的路径ID。 链接ID是从链路的任一组上的节点ID创建的。 当创建路径ID以便于路径的排序时,链接ID从最低到最高排序。 从这个排名列表中选择低和高排名的路径作为通过网络的第一组不同路径。 然后,每个路径上的每个链路ID被重命名,例如通过反转所有高节点ID或低节点ID。 在链接重新命名之后,通过连接重命名的链接ID的有序集来创建新的路径ID。 然后将路径重新排序,并且从该重新排列的列表中选择低和高重新排序的路径作为通过网络的第二组不同路径。 可以利用节点ID的选择性命名和不同的反演功能的使用来进一步优化网络上的流量分配。

    Provider link state bridging (PLSB) computation method
    10.
    发明授权
    Provider link state bridging (PLSB) computation method 有权
    提供商链路状态桥接(PLSB)计算方法

    公开(公告)号:US08005016B2

    公开(公告)日:2011-08-23

    申请号:US12259650

    申请日:2008-10-28

    IPC分类号: H04L12/28

    摘要: A method of multicast route computation in a link state protocol controlled network. A spanning tree is computed from a first node to every other node in the network using a known spanning tree protocol. The network is then divided into two or more partitions, each partition encompassing an immediate neighbor node of the first node and any nodes of the network subtending the neighbor node on the spanning tree. Two or more of the partitions are merged when a predetermined criterion is satisfied. Nodes within all of the partitions except a largest one of the partitions are then identified, and each identified node examined to identify node pairs for which a respective shortest path traverses the first node.

    摘要翻译: 一种链路状态协议控制网络中组播路由计算的方法。 使用已知的生成树协议从网络中的第一节点到每个其他节点计算生成树。 然后将网络划分成两个或更多个分区,每个分区包含第一节点的直接邻居节点和对生成树上的邻居节点的网络的任何节点。 当满足预定标准时,两个或多个分区被合并。 然后识别除了最大分区之外的所有分区内的节点,并且检查每个识别的节点以识别相应的最短路径穿过第一节点的节点对。